Why Does Drip Coffee Have More Caffeine Than Espresso?

Drip coffee has more total caffeine than espresso because of its significantly larger serving size. While espresso is highly concentrated at roughly 63 milligrams of caffeine per ounce, you typically only drink a 2-ounce double shot (126 mg). In contrast, a 12-ounce drip coffee contains approximately 144 milligrams of caffeine.

This counter-intuitive reality often confuses coffee drinkers. The myth that espresso is the most highly caffeinated beverage stems from its intense, bold flavor. However, to understand total caffeine intake, you must distinguish between concentration per ounce and total serving volume. Understanding how automatic drip coffee machines work compared to high-pressure espresso extraction helps clarify this paradox.

Beverage Type Standard Serving Size Caffeine Per Ounce (Concentration) Total Caffeine Per Serving
Standard Drip Coffee 12 oz (355 ml) ~12 mg ~144 mg
Single Shot Espresso 1 oz (30 ml) ~63 mg ~63 mg
Double Shot Espresso 2 oz (60 ml) ~63 mg ~126 mg

While a shot of espresso packs a concentrated punch, it is over in a few sips. A standard drip coffee vs espresso caffeine comparison reveals that the prolonged sipping of a larger drip brew ultimately delivers a higher total stimulant load to your system.

How Does The Caffeine Content Per Ounce Compare?

Espresso contains roughly 63 milligrams of caffeine per fluid ounce, making it about five times more concentrated than drip coffee, which contains approximately 12 milligrams per fluid ounce. This massive difference in liquid concentration dictates the beverage strength and flavor profile.

Laboratory measurements utilizing HPLC (High-Performance Liquid Chromatography) analysis confirm these exact metrics. When you order an espresso shot, you are consuming a tiny, potent liquid extraction. If you were to drink 12 ounces of straight espresso, you would ingest a dangerous 756 milligrams of caffeine. By understanding this per-ounce math, you can easily calculate custom drink sizes and accurately manage your caffeine content per fluid ounce.

Does Drip Coffee Have More Caffeine Than Cold Brew And French Press?

Standard drip coffee typically contains more caffeine than French press, but less caffeine than undiluted cold brew concentrate. An 8-ounce drip coffee yields about 95-120 mg of caffeine. An equivalent French press yields roughly 80-107 mg, while an 8-ounce serving of cold brew can exceed 150 mg depending on the dilution ratio.

To rank your preferred morning brewing methods accurately, you must recognize the mechanical differences between percolation [water passing continuously through a filter] and immersion [grounds steeping directly in water]. Drip coffee and pour over chemex brewing both utilize percolation. French press and cold brew utilize immersion. These mechanical differences dramatically alter the final caffeine yield.

According to brewing standards from the Specialty Coffee Association, the water-to-coffee ratios in immersion vs. percolation methods dictate extraction efficiency. What most guides miss is that cold brew steeping extracts comparable caffeine to drip because of its extended 12-to-24-hour contact time, compensating for the lack of hot water.

Brewing Method Extraction Type Standard 8 oz Caffeine Yield Key Variable Impacting Caffeine
Auto Drip Coffee Percolation 95 – 120 mg Flow rate and water temperature
Cold Brew Immersion 102 – 159 mg Coffee-to-water ratio and steep time
French Press Immersion 80 – 107 mg Coarse grind size slows extraction
Pour-Over Manual Percolation 100 – 140 mg Slow pouring increases contact time
  • Cold Brew Concentrate: Requires massive amounts of coffee grounds and a 12-24 hour steep, creating a highly caffeinated concentrate that is usually diluted before drinking.
  • Auto Drip Coffee: Efficiently extracts caffeine using continuous hot water flow and medium-fine grounds, creating a balanced, reliable yield.
  • Pour-Over: Extracts slightly more caffeine than auto-drip if the barista pours slowly, increasing the water’s contact time with the grounds.
  • French Press: Yields lower caffeine because the required coarse grind size significantly slows the extraction rate, despite the immersion environment.

How Much Caffeine Is In A 12 oz, 16 oz, And 8 oz Cup Of Drip Coffee?

The amount of caffeine in drip coffee scales directly with the cup size you consume. An 8 oz cup contains approximately 95 mg, a 12 oz standard mug holds about 144 mg, and a 16 oz large cup yields roughly 190 mg. Commercial coffees, like a 16 oz Starbucks Grande, often contain up to 310 mg.

Most people do not drink a standard 8-ounce cup. To accurately measure your daily intake, you must translate these baseline statistics into the real-world vessel you hold in your hand. From our practical experience, eliminating the frustrating “per ounce” math gives you instant clarity on your consumption.

Here is the precise breakdown for standard home-brewed drip coffee sizes:

  1. 8 oz (Standard Cup): 90 to 100 milligrams of caffeine.
  2. 12 oz (Regular Mug): 135 to 150 milligrams of caffeine.
  3. 16 oz (Travel Mug): 180 to 200 milligrams of caffeine.
  4. 20 oz (Thermos): 225 to 250 milligrams of caffeine.

When you purchase coffee away from home, the rules change entirely. Verified nutritional data published by commercial brands reveals that shop-brewed coffee is significantly stronger. If you are wondering how much caffeine is in starbucks drip coffee, you must account for their heavy brewing ratios.

Cup Size (Fluid Ounces) Common Name Estimated Home Brew Caffeine Commercial Shop Equivalent (e.g., Starbucks)
8 oz (236 ml) Small / Standard Cup 90 – 100 mg 155 mg (Short)
12 oz (355 ml) Regular Mug 135 – 150 mg 235 mg (Tall)
16 oz (473 ml) Large / Travel Mug 180 – 200 mg 310 mg (Grande)
20 oz (591 ml) Extra Large 225 – 250 mg 410 mg (Venti)

Does Light Roast Drip Coffee Have More Caffeine Than Dark Roast?

By weight, light roast and dark roast coffee contain the exact same amount of caffeine. However, the roasting process causes dark roast beans to expand and lose mass. If you measure your coffee with a standard scoop (volume), light roast beans pack more densely, resulting in slightly more caffeine per cup.

This is the most persistent myth in the coffee world. Many drinkers assume that a bold, bitter dark roast equates to high caffeine concentration. In reality, caffeine is incredibly stable during the roasting process. The science of pyrolysis [chemical decomposition at elevated temperatures] shows that caffeine thermal stability remains intact even at extreme roasting temperatures.

Here is the critical insight most guides miss: the difference lies entirely in how you measure the beans. Think of light roast beans as dense rocks, and dark roast beans as expanded popcorn. If you fill a single scoop with dense “rocks” (light roast), you capture more total beans. If you fill a scoop with expanded “popcorn” (dark roast), you capture fewer beans. Therefore, measuring by volume yields more caffeine for light roasts. If you use a kitchen scale to measure by exact weight in grams, the caffeine levels in light roast drip coffee vs dark roast are virtually identical.

Does Arabica Drip Coffee Have Less Caffeine Than Robusta?

Robusta coffee beans contain roughly twice the amount of caffeine as Arabica beans. Using 100% Robusta beans for drip coffee will nearly double the caffeine content of your final cup compared to standard Arabica blends.

When you analyze biological bean factors, the genetic alkaloid content dictates the final strength. Exact laboratory measurement averages show that Arabica beans contain approximately 1.2% to 1.5% caffeine by weight. In stark contrast, Robusta beans contain 2.2% to 2.7% caffeine by weight. If you want to aggressively maximize your intake, look for bags labeled as “espresso blends” or “high caffeine,” which frequently utilize Robusta vs Arabica caffeine content in drip coffee to boost the stimulant load.

What Factors Influence Caffeine Levels In Drip Coffee?

To maximize caffeine extraction in drip coffee, optimize your grind size, water temperature, and brew ratio. Water heated between 195°F and 205°F accelerates caffeine solubility. Additionally, using a slightly finer grind size increases the surface area of the beans, allowing the water to extract caffeine more efficiently during the brew cycle.

You possess complete control over your home brewing process. By manipulating the physical brewing parameters, you can intentionally increase or decrease your caffeine output. The Journal of Agricultural and Food Chemistry notes that mass transfer coefficients and caffeine solubility curves change drastically based on how you set up your machine.

To actively manipulate extracting caffeine, focus on these three core variables:

  1. Water Temperature Extraction: Caffeine dissolves rapidly in hot water. If your drip machine heats water to the optimal 195°F to 205°F range, it pulls caffeine efficiently. Cold or lukewarm water leaves precious caffeine trapped inside the grounds.
  2. Grind Size Surface Area: Grind size affects water contact and caffeine release directly. A coarse grind acts like a boulder, letting water wash over it quickly. A finer grind acts like pebbles, providing a massive surface area for the hot water to extract the caffeine alkaloids.
  3. Brewing Contact Time: The longer the water sits in contact with the coffee grounds, the more caffeine it extracts. Slower drip machines will inherently produce a more heavily caffeinated beverage than rapid-brew models.

Is 200 mg Of Caffeine In Drip Coffee Too Much?

Consuming 200 mg of caffeine in a single cup of drip coffee is generally safe and represents exactly half of the FDA’s recommended daily limit of 400 mg. However, drinking 200 mg in one sitting may cause jitters or stomach irritation for individuals with caffeine sensitivity.

Understanding the math is useless if you do not contextualize it against your personal health. According to clinical nutrition caffeine metabolism limits, a 200 mg dose is a standard, robust morning boost for a healthy adult. This is roughly equivalent to drinking one 16-ounce travel mug of home-brewed drip coffee before leaving for work.

While the FDA recommends maximum 400mg caffeine daily, consuming half your daily limit in a single rapid dose requires observation. If you experience adverse side effects from a 200 mg cup, consider these caffeine jitter prevention strategies:

  • Switch to Half-Caf: Blend 50% regular beans with 50% decaf beans to instantly cut your 200 mg dose down to 100 mg without sacrificing your preferred cup size.
  • Pace Your Consumption: Instead of drinking a 16-ounce mug in twenty minutes, sip an 8-ounce cup at 7:00 AM and a second 8-ounce cup at 10:00 AM.
  • Monitor Stomach Irritation: Caffeine accelerates gastric acid production. Always consume your morning drip coffee alongside food to buffer the alkaloid impact.

How Much Caffeine Remains In Decaf Drip Coffee?

A standard 8-ounce cup of decaffeinated drip coffee contains between 2 and 5 milligrams of caffeine. By law, the decaffeination process must remove at least 97 percent of the beans’ original caffeine content, meaning trace amounts will always remain in the final brew.

If you hit your 400mg FDA limit early in the day, decaf is a brilliant solution. However, you must understand that “decaf” does not mean “caffeine-free.” Whether the roaster uses the Swiss Water process or chemical solvents, the decaffeination removes 97 percent of caffeine in drip coffee, leaving a tiny, generally imperceptible stimulant residue behind.

Frequently Asked Questions About Drip Coffee Caffeine Content

Does reusable filter change caffeine content in drip coffee?

Using a metal reusable filter slightly increases the caffeine and oil content in your drip coffee compared to a paper filter.

Paper filters are dense enough to trap certain coffee oils (cafestol) and can slightly restrict the flow rate. Because metal filters allow micro-fines and oils to pass into the final cup, you retain marginally more total dissolved solids, resulting in a microscopic increase in total caffeine yield.

How much caffeine is in a Tall Starbucks drip coffee?

A 12-ounce Tall drip coffee from Starbucks contains approximately 235 milligrams of caffeine.

Starbucks brews their standard drip coffee with a very high coffee-to-water ratio compared to standard home brewing standards. This results in a significantly stronger caffeine concentration, making a Tall Starbucks coffee nearly as caffeinated as a 20-ounce home-brewed cup.

How much caffeine is in 7 Brew drip coffee?

A standard medium house coffee from 7 Brew contains approximately 150 to 180 milligrams of caffeine.

While specific proprietary data can vary, 7 Brew utilizes standard commercial drip extraction methods. Similar to other commercial drive-thru chains, their batch brews are concentrated, yielding roughly 12 to 15 milligrams of caffeine per fluid ounce depending on the specific roast profile used that day.

Does finer grind size increase caffeine in drip coffee?

Yes, using a finer grind size for your drip coffee increases the caffeine extraction.

Finer grounds have a much larger total surface area exposed to the hot water. This increased surface area allows the water to dissolve the caffeine alkaloids much faster during the short contact time of an automatic drip cycle, yielding a stronger, more highly caffeinated cup.

How does brewing time affect caffeine in drip coffee?

Longer brewing times increase the total amount of caffeine extracted from the coffee grounds.

Caffeine is highly water-soluble, meaning the longer the coffee grounds are submerged in hot water, the more caffeine is pulled into the final beverage. If your automatic drip machine has a slower flow rate or a longer steep cycle, the resulting coffee will have a higher caffeine concentration.

Can drip coffee have 200 mg of caffeine?

Yes, a single cup of drip coffee can easily exceed 200 mg of caffeine depending on the serving size and brewing ratio.

While an 8-ounce cup averages 95 mg, consuming a standard 16-ounce travel mug of home-brewed coffee will yield roughly 190 to 200 mg. Furthermore, commercial coffees like a 16-ounce Starbucks Grande contain over 300 mg of caffeine.

Which drip coffee has the most caffeine?

Drip coffee brewed with 100% Robusta beans using a high coffee-to-water ratio will yield the most caffeine.

Robusta beans contain roughly double the caffeine of standard Arabica beans. Combining a fine grind of light-roast Robusta beans with water heated to 205°F in a slow-drip machine will produce the highest legally available caffeine concentration for a standard drip brew.

Is drip coffee higher in caffeine than pour over?

Standard automatic drip coffee and manual pour-over coffee contain nearly identical amounts of caffeine, averaging 95 to 120 mg per 8 ounces.

Both methods rely on percolation (water passing through a bed of grounds). The caffeine variation between the two depends entirely on the specific barista’s pour rate, the water temperature, and the exact gram weight of coffee used, rather than the equipment itself.

How much caffeine do you extract in a 5 minute drip cycle?

A standard 5-minute automatic drip cycle extracts approximately 90% to 95% of the available caffeine from the coffee grounds.

Because caffeine is one of the first chemical compounds to dissolve in hot water, the vast majority of the alkaloid is pulled into the carafe within the first two minutes of the brewing cycle. The remaining minutes primarily extract flavors, oils, and bitter compounds.

What are the symptoms of a caffeine crash from drip coffee?

A caffeine crash from drinking too much drip coffee typically involves sudden fatigue, irritability, inability to concentrate, and headaches.

This occurs because caffeine blocks adenosine receptors in the brain. Once the high dose of caffeine from a large drip coffee metabolizes and clears your system, the accumulated adenosine floods the receptors, causing a rapid onset of tiredness usually 3 to 4 hours after consumption.
